Last test day at Jerez

26 January 2023

Jerez-Spain

Test

Lorenzo Baldassarri and the GMT94 Yamaha have had a good start to the season in Jerez.

Lorenzo Baldassarri and the GMT94 can leave Jerez satisfied after two days of positive testing. The 131 laps completed throughout the test have allowed the team and the number 34 to do some constructive work with the new Yamaha YZF-R1.

Lorenzo Baldassarri: “A new team, a new bike… this first test was really positive. We worked step by step to understand the bike, both the electronics and the set-up. It was a discovery for everyone. I’m really happy because we improved with every ride. Even if we are still far from the best lap times, we are going in the right direction. Thanks to the team, to Christophe Guyot, they managed to prepare the motorbike in time during a very short off-season, we are looking forward to the next tests in Portimao.”

Christophe Guyot (Team Manager):

“Really positive tests, we are very satisfied with the work of Lorenzo and the team. The battle plan was respected, Lorenzo has a great potential, we could see it in his last run with a very good ideal time. A motorbike that works well, the technical support of Yamaha, no mistakes, no crashes, we enter the Superbike category with a smile. We will approach Portimao as we did Jerez and then we will work on the lap times by switching to more tyres as our rivals did.
